The Schneider BMXDD03202K provides 32 discrete output channels for Modicon M340 systems. This module controls actuators, relays, and indicator lights from the PLC. Therefore, it connects the controller to field equipment in industrial automation.

Product Overview

We designed this output module for high-density control in compact cabinets. Its 32 points occupy minimal rack space while delivering substantial current. Moreover, this unit includes channel-level diagnostic feedback for troubleshooting.

Output Stage Design

The Schneider BMXDD03202K uses power MOSFETs on each output channel. Its four ceramic capacitors filter noise on the internal logic supply. Additionally, two electrolytic capacitors store energy for brief overload events. You get reliable switching without external suppression components.

Energy Storage Components

Four ceramic capacitors decouple high-frequency noise from the backplane. Two electrolytic capacitors provide charge for inrush current demands. A solenoid may draw 2A for its initial 10 ms pull-in period. These capacitors supply that surge without dropping the control voltage. After the inrush, the current drops to the 0.5A holding level.

Installation Steps

Insert this module into any M340 rack slot with a backplane connector. Align the Schneider BMXDD03202K with the plastic guide rails. Push the module firmly until its locking mechanism clicks into place. Then secure the module with the top and bottom retaining screws. Connect the external wiring to the removable terminal block.

Channel Grouping

Channels 0 through 7 share a common return (C0). Each common return can carry up to 4A continuously. Distribute high-current loads across multiple groups for balance.

Diagnostic Features

Each output includes open-circuit and short-circuit detection. The module reports a fault when a channel draws no current despite being on. It also reports a fault when a channel exceeds 1.5A continuously. An LED indicator next to each channel shows its status. A red LED indicates a fault, while green means normal operation.

Wiring Recommendations

Use 18 AWG to 22 AWG wire for all output connections. Strip each wire to 8 mm of exposed conductor before insertion. Push the wire into the spring cage terminal until it stops. To release a wire, insert a 2.5mm screwdriver into the release slot. The removable terminal block accepts field wiring before you insert it.
